Soprolux: banking documents and customer data released after a cyberattack
In May 2026, the BravoX ransomware group claimed a double-extortion attack on Soprolux, a French food distributor serving restaurants and professional clients, publishing banking documents, SEPA mandates, IBAN/RIB details and customer and supplier records to pressure the company.

On 8 May 2026, Soprolux — a French distributor of food and specialty products serving restaurants and professional clients, primarily in eastern France — was named as a victim by the BravoX ransomware group, which claimed to have breached the company and published internal documents and databases to back its claims.
BravoX operated a classic double-extortion scheme, combining the encryption of the victim's systems with the threat to publish stolen data unless a ransom was negotiated. To substantiate the claim, the group leaked samples of internal files, including commercial spreadsheets and management data covering Soprolux's network of restaurant partners, suppliers and commercial contacts.
The exposed data reportedly included:
- Professional client and prospect lists
- Company contact details and executive/management information
- Email addresses and phone numbers
- Tax records and VAT numbers
- SEPA direct-debit mandates
- Bank account details (RIB/IBAN)
- Internal commercial spreadsheets and management data
The leaked banking details and SEPA mandates create a significant fraud risk: affected businesses were urged to stay alert to identity theft, phishing, and fraudulent IBAN-change or payment requests. As of disclosure, no public response or confirmation from Soprolux had been reported, and the overall scale of the breach (number of records or clients) was not disclosed.
